3GPP and Mobile Companies Announce 5G Standalone Spec

The mobile industry announced today that the 3GPP  has approved the 5G standalone specifications, which will pave the way towards the development of 5G networks that don’t rely on existing 4G networks (5G development has thus far had to leverage existing 4G technology as opposed to being a truly new and independent technology). The “Release 15” 5G standard, which took 34 months collaboration from countless industry contributors, sets forth the standards that will serve as the baseline of 5G development and deployment around the world.

Balázs Bertényi, Chairman of 3GPP TSG RAN, said: “The freeze of Standalone 5G NR radio specifications represents a major milestone in the quest of the wireless industry towards realizing the holistic 5G vision. 5G NR Standalone systems not only dramatically increase the mobile broadband speeds and capacity, but also open the door for new industries beyond telecommunications that are looking to revolutionize their ecosystem through 5G.”
